Camping itself has always existed on a spectrum, from minimalists sleeping in remote wilderness areas to RVers in parking lots. Glamping has emerged as a way of pushing the envelope on the posh end of things, sometimes in spectacularly extravagant ways, but it can be more simple than that, too.<\/p>\n<h2><strong>What is Glamping? <\/strong><\/h2>\n<p>The word itself is, not surprisingly, a mashup of \u201cglamour\u201d and \u201ccamping.\u201d Just as classic camping has always existed on a spectrum, so does glamping. On the one end, uber-luxe options are essentially five-star hotel suites installed in a spectacular outdoor setting. At the other end, where most glampers live, are those who simply elevate their car camping setup so it feels more like a cozy home. This type of glamping is a great way to introduce a new camper to the outdoors, or to celebrate a special occasion.<\/p>\n<h2><strong>What Makes Glamping Different From Camping?<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p>The big differentiator is comfort level. You\u2019re semi-roughing it. That said, there are no hard-and-fast rules. When you book a glamping getaway, the provider may set up your campsite for you and offer luxuries such as a spa-like private shower or room in your tent for a \u201ccloset\u201d where you can unpack and hang your clothes. But every experience will be unique.<\/p>\n<p>DIY glamping may be as simple as adding a bigger tent, a plusher mattress or gourmet cookware. Decorative campsite touches are also part of the fun; think of it as outdoor decorating with an outfitter\u2019s sensibility. Bring Cozy Bedding<\/strong><\/strong><\/p>\n<p><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"size-article_body wp-image-38169\" src=\"https:\/\/www.rei.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/4\/2018\/08\/glamping_bedding.jpg?resize=1024%2C655\" alt=\"Cozy bedding\" width=\"1024\" height=\"655\" \/><\/p>\n<p>The true key to glamping is having a luxurious, comfy bed to retire to at the end of the day. Start with a comfy base like an elevated cot or a massively plush sleeping mattress. Make the bed with an insulating layer, some soft sheets, a comforter and lots of pillows. Complete the room with side tables, a rug, slippers and your favorite reading material. Set Up Stations<\/strong><\/p>\n<p><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"alignnone size-article_body wp-image-38175\" src=\"https:\/\/www.rei.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/4\/2018\/08\/glamping_stations.jpg?resize=1024%2C655\" alt=\"Camping stations\" width=\"1024\" height=\"655\" \/><br \/>Create areas with labeled ingredients and\/or steps for all to enjoy at their leisure. A handwashing station with soapy and clean water, sanitizer and towels is great to keep kids somewhat clean. An energy station with snacks (in critter-proof containers), drinks and battery power to recharge electronics will keep people happy all day long. An evening s\u2019mores station with a variety of choices will let people get creative with their campfire classic.<\/p>\n<p><strong>7.
